How Does Bowl Material Influence the Mixing of Sourdough Bread?
Bowl material influences the mixing of sourdough bread in several important ways. Different materials have distinct thermal properties, which affect dough temperature. For example, metal bowls retain cold and can lead to cooler dough. Glass and ceramic bowls maintain a neutral temperature, allowing for better temperature control during mixing. The texture of the bowl also impacts the mixing process. Smooth surfaces, like those in glass or metal bowls, allow for easier kneading and mixing, while rough surfaces can create friction and hinder uniform mixing.
Another factor is the chemical reactivity of the materials. Certain materials, like aluminum, can react with acidic components in sourdough, altering flavors and affecting fermentation. Non-reactive materials, such as stainless steel, glass, or ceramic, do not react with the dough, preserving the sourdough’s intended flavor profile.
Additionally, the size and shape of the bowl affect the mixing process. A deep, wide bowl provides ample space for the dough to expand and develop. This promotes thorough incorporation of ingredients. Ultimately, the choice of bowl material impacts dough consistency, temperature, flavor, and overall mixing efficiency, which are all crucial for successful sourdough bread.

How Does Bowl Shape Affect the Mixing Process for Sourdough?
The shape of the bowl affects the mixing process for sourdough. A deeper bowl allows for better containment of the dough during mixing. This shape prevents spills and helps maintain the moisture within the dough. A wider bowl promotes better incorporation of ingredients due to increased surface area. Wide bowls also allow for easier access when using hands or tools.
Additionally, the angle of the bowl’s sides influences the mixing technique. Steep sides can trap flour and dough, making it harder to mix thoroughly. Gently sloped sides facilitate movement and mixing, allowing ingredients to combine more efficiently. A bowl with a smooth interior surface allows for easier scraping and folding, which improves dough structure.
Moreover, the material of the bowl matters. Ceramic and glass bowls retain temperature better than plastic. This retention benefits the fermentation process, which is crucial for sourdough. Overall, bowl shape, depth, and material contribute significantly to the effectiveness of mixing sourdough.
